Food & Drinks
Gyros and comfort food collide in a greasy symphony that feels right at home in this sports bar. The gyros are generous, stuffed with juicy meat and fresh toppings that make a perfect pairing with their crispy fries. The drink menu? Not too shabby — they’ve got a decent beer lineup that won’t break the bank. Pints hover around $5. It’s not the place for craft cocktail connoisseurs, but if you’re in the mood for a cold one while you scream at the TV, you’re in good hands.
